Búsqueda de museos y pinturas

Portsmouth es una ciudad y autoridad unitaria en el sudeste de Inglaterra, en el Reino Unido.[1]​[2]​ Pertenece al condado ceremonial de Hampshire. Portsmouth, conocida popularmente como Pompey, se extiende sobre la isla de Portsea, frente a la isla de Wight en el canal de la Mancha, que a su vez conforma la ría natural de Portsmouth Harbour, formación geográfica favorable para el refugio y las actividades marítimas que han forjado en parte el carácter histórico y económico de la ciudad. Su población, según estimaciones de 2014, se eleva a 209 085 habitantes en su término municipal,[3]​ y a cerca de 443 000 en el área metropolitana que comprende los términos de Fareham, Portchester, Gosport, Havant , Lee-on-the-Solent, Stubbington y Waterlooville. Es la ciudad de nacimiento del novelista Charles Dickens.

HMS Excellent (shore establishment)

HMS Excellent is a Royal Navy "stone frigate" sited on Whale Island near Portsmouth in Hampshire. HMS Excellent is itself part of the Maritime Warfare School, with a headquarters at HMS Collingwood, although a number of lodger units are resident within the site, the principal of which is the headquarters of Fleet Commander .

Royal Marines Museum

The Royal Marines Museum is a museum on the history of the Royal Marines from their beginnings in 1664 through to the present day. A registered charity, it is also a designated service museum under the terms of the National Heritage Act 1983 and receives Grant-in-Aid from the Ministry of Defence. During 2011 it formally became part of the National Museum of the Royal Navy, an executive non-departmental public body of the Ministry of Defence. The museum's galleries are currently closed, pending relocation.

Portsmouth City Museum

Portsmouth Museum is a local museum in Museum Road in the city of Portsmouth, southern England. It is one of six museums run by Portsmouth Museums, part of Portsmouth City Council. The museum is housed in a Grade II listed building.

Portsmouth Historic Dockyard

Portsmouth Historic Dockyard is an area of HM Naval Base Portsmouth which is open to the public; it contains several historic buildings and ships. It is managed by the National Museum of the Royal Navy as an umbrella organisation representing five charities: the Portsmouth Naval Base Property Trust, the National Museum of the Royal Navy, Portsmouth, the Mary Rose Trust, the Warrior Preservation Trust Ltd and the HMS Victory Preservation Company. Portsmouth Historic Dockyard Ltd was created to promote and manage the tourism element of the Royal Navy Dockyard, with the relevant trusts maintaining and interpreting their own attractions. It also promotes other nearby navy-related tourist attractions.

University of Portsmouth

The University of Portsmouth is a public university in the city of Portsmouth, Hampshire, England. It was previously known as Portsmouth Polytechnic from 1969 until 1992, when it was granted university status through the Further and Higher Education Act 1992. It is ranked among the Top 100 universities under 50 in the world. The university offers a range of disciplines, from Pharmacy, International relations and politics, to Mechanical Engineering, Mathematics, Paleontology, Criminology, Criminal Justice, among others. The University is a member of the University Alliance and The Channel Islands Universities Consortium. Alumni include Tim Peake, Grayson Perry, Simon Armitage and Ben Fogle.
